New York: Secuirty Council of the United Nations expressed concerned over the turmoil in Libya in which over 300 people have been killed.
A meeting of the council was held to discuss the issue of Libya and strongly condemned the loss of lifes. The meeting unanimously demanded Libyan authorities to stop the violence in Libya immediately.
It was also decided in the meeting taht all the persons involved in the violencent clashes would be given examplary punishment.
